Grand Imperial Porter

Grand Imperial Porter is a representative of the Baltic Porter style. From the first sip, it delights with the taste of roasted grains combined with notes of chocolate, coffee, caramel and noticeable nuances of dried fruit. It is distinguished by an extremely dense, creamy head with a perfect structure. Perfect for desserts, especially dark chocolate.

The main distinguishing features of the Baltic porter are the use of bottom-fermenting yeast, roasted malts and long aging. Style enthusiasts additionally extend this time, which, under the right conditions, refines the taste.

In our brewery, we draw on the tradition of brewing in Pomerania. Therefore, the Baltic porter was the obvious choice. Its recipe was developed in the 19th century in the countries of the Baltic Sea basin and in Russia. It was a replacement for the Russian imperial stout imported from Great Britain.

Porter perfectly complements the taste of desserts. Some people add a scoop of ice cream to it. In a dry version, it perfectly harmonizes with hearty red meat dishes.

Serve in a goblet glass at a temperature of 12-14°C.

Ingredients water from own deep water intakes; pale and dark barley roasted malts; aromatic and bitter hops; bottom-fermenting yeast from own propagation station
Brewing method traditional; bottom fermentation; long aging
Pasteurization yes
Style Baltic porter
Color black
Best before date 365 days
Extract 18,1%
ABV 8%
